Plant Evergreens

Evergreen plants flourish even the cold temperatures of Fall and Winter. Large properties can accommodate both shrubs and trees, so you have more plant options. On the other hand, small areas can use shrubs like holly or boxwood. Because they’re evergreen, they’ll contrast well with the golden hues of Autumn foliage.

Add a Big Tree

A big yard should have a huge tree that changes color during Fall. You may choose from a broad selection of Autumn trees for your front or backyard. Add a sugar maple tree in your backyard for its amazing foliage. Its leaves turn a beautiful shade of red, orange, or yellow when the season comes around. You can also plant shrubs or other flowering bushes underneath it for added depth.



Plant Autumn Flowers

Mums or chrysanthemums will look great in your garden with their Fall colors. You can pick out the colors that you want and tailor-fit them to the season you want them to shine in. Red, orange, and yellow will give your garden that golden Fall look. Heleniums are also great flowers to have in Autumn. They bloom in red and orange, just the perfect shades for the season. On the other hand, if you prefer more bright hues in your garden for the season, consider New England asters. These daisy-like perennials come in pink, mauve, white, and even blue. They’re perfect for that pop of color on your patio.

Add Groundcovers

Many sprouts can’t stand cold weather. That’s why it’s important to include plants that can endure the harsh conditions of Autumn, and eventually, Winter. You can plant groundcovers to make your garden look interesting this Fall. Look into plants like creeping wintergreen for mossy foliage even in colder months. Meanwhile, cranberry cotoneaster sprouts beautiful red fruits for a wonderful burst of color during Fall and Winter.
